Choosing a dentist
Before you decide to visit a dentist, you should do some research. Visit dentist offices and websites to get an idea of the services they offer. Bring along your dental records if you have them. Make sure the office is clean and welcoming. Ask for references and inquire about fees. Visit the top choices and see how they treat their patients. If they are friendly and thorough, you’ll feel much better about visiting them. After all, you’re looking after your oral health, right?

When choosing a dentist, don’t be afraid to ask questions. Often, the answers you receive will have a bearing on your decision. Don’t be afraid to ask questions, as any hesitation can be a sign that you’re not getting the service you need. Read customer reviews to get a better idea of what to expect. A dentist should be warm and friendly, and he or she should be able to address any concerns you may have.

Choosing a dentist with a variety of services
If you have a family, choosing a dentist that offers many services can be beneficial. Some family dentists offer a range of services, including teeth whitening and dentures. Others specialize in one particular service, such as orthodontics. The list of services provided by a dentist will help you find one that fits your needs and budget. You might not need a specific service today, but you may need it at some point in the future.
Another important factor to consider when choosing a dentist is the materials they use for fillings. While many dental offices still use amalgam or mercury fillings, there are other dentists who use composite or resin fillings. Make sure that you feel comfortable with the type of fillings your dentist uses. Modern technology makes it easier to receive your treatment in a comfortable and efficient manner. Choosing a dentist based on insurance
Choosing a dentist based on insurance is important for several reasons. Many people choose their dentist based on the dentist’s experience and reputation. Some have a preferred dentist, and others simply like to be near their current dentist, or are loyal to the same dentist. But it can be difficult to figure out what your options are once you have an insurance plan. Here are a few things to consider. First, determine whether your insurance will cover your dentist.
Dental insurance typically covers preventive care and a percentage of therapies, including root canals. Choosing a dentist based on your insurance plan can make life easier if you know the terminology. Learn about the various types of plans so that you can choose the one that suits your needs best. It’s also essential to determine if the dentist you choose is in the network of your insurance company. While most PPO plans will cover dental work done by a non-member dentist, some HMO plans have restrictions that can make the process more difficult.
Choosing a dentist by word-of-mouth
When looking for a dentist, word-of-mouth recommendations are the best way to go. Ask family, friends, and even local groups and social media sites for recommendations. Check out online reviews of dentists, too. You can read the most recent testimonials from customers on various websites. You can also reach out to previous patients who’ve filled out rating surveys about their experiences. After you get a recommendation from friends, make an appointment for a dental checkup and you’re on your way!
